Type
ORACLE
Validation date
2024-03-08 13:29: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04034,
    "usd": 0.04412
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C6C9297CEF20531319B342AFECD5E7467B26742B6251FE06A32C5DEAAA6618E7

Previous signature

7F6CEAF912658B5B75E8FD857F9C2E403B7D04F1604A4D79DC5627016A005B01870A1B6F34FC4172BDD6BCBF7EB30FEE04E1EDDA6E7E85B01312BFE9C9FAF404

Origin signature

304502200AFA967AFFEF7A2561C5BBB95FF09A56FCFED7A7BF0EE59B363BC2718A914EBC022100FA5D443A298100C099E6EB6EB7A5107DD3268EC11D74D495D4BA9ED2B0AD9261

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

007432DDCB45B727B4B51A39CF233F8E0EB2651FDD40A2918A8EA2D7881E5A1BDD

Coordinator signature

D141213D152A9873AF4DC88F25617360588150168DAC997CDFD0391D3902404D3005CB5B7A26B54964D17B2641C31549B5CB4E0F85F888F371D9CA6AD523880A

Validator #1 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#1 signature

2EB497481B0AEE19B805EC373ECA71D5D393B96573A32E03ABC6D40DD3856EE2F3DBCEA3353A056DCED2DF1BF1E2A542201E656CD1BEF345E4490F8C81608007

Validator #2 public key

0001FE0F759D8C583CB8351DB3F1BA2F045F114F0BA7600CCEC9048E48CC3E5FE4AF

Validator #2 signature

EE77A8FD56AC20C4847EF13BAE01F31A3748A8C285471F666910E9C735ADD75D54B552D3163E84A02F161C05960E8A5B08EAACADAC6011775C323D8ECAF1C00C